Step back into the 1930s Delta with Memphis Minnie – Guitar Queen (1935) [Lost Paramount Reels], an imagined but vivid rediscovery of one of the greatest guitarists and singers in blues history. Long before the world celebrated women in rock, there was Memphis Minnie — fierce, bold, and unmatched on her steel-body resonator guitar. 🎶 Why Memphis Minnie is a Legend Called the “Queen of the Blues,” she was one of the first women to master guitar with fiery skill and stage power. Her style blended Delta traditions with sharp, rhythmic picking and slide, influencing generations from Muddy Waters to Bonnie Raitt.
